Default Access 2003 report parameter problem

Hi,

This worked in previous versions of Access, but not 2003. This is an
adp. Not sure if it is an adp/report/form or some other problem.

I have a form which has a property, prpWasAutoID, and a command button
that opens a report.

The report's recordsource is a parameterized stored procedure. The
input parameter of the report is as follows:
@pintWasAutoID=forms!frmWas.prpwasAutoID

At the time the report opens, debug confirms a valid value for
forms!frmWas.prpwasAutoID, however Access errors with a popup request
for the value. I've tried various ways of referencing the property
like forms("frmWas").prpWasAutoID but so far nothing works.

There are no reference errors and the app complies okay. Same app
works fine in Access 2000 and XP.

Any ideas appreciated
